We stayed at Pension Balbin on Balbinova near the Muzeum Metro & Wenceslas Square. It is clean, shower & toilet in room, good buffet breakfast, on top floors of apartment building with locked door to street so safe and within 5-10 minute walking distance to just about anywhere you want to go. It was $80/2 during high season a year ago. Check www.avetravel.cz or nethotels.com for information. The Charles Bridge at night is great view.

From one Vicky to another, except for spelling, Prague is the most beautiful city I've been to. Yes, even better than Paris! I was there 2 years ago with my husband and it is lovely. We were there for 3 days and it's a charming city. Hoya is "medicated" but if your friend is also female, just be careful at night. I read up on Prague and true to the books, everyone's out for a buck don't be afraid to haggle. For example, if you're taking taxi's negotiate the price/fare before you get in or you'll be ripped off! Haggleing is also almost expected in the stores so go for it, you have nothing to lose. <BR>I think, no, I know you'll enjoy Prague. Have a GREAT time!

Hi Vicki, Prague is a beautiful city. There is quite a bit to do. There are a number concerts going on most of the time. In the town square in the old city there is the astrological clock and yound people dressed in period cosumes selling tickets for concerts. The Science and Industry museum is great although the National museum is not so interesting. The buildings are great, really colorfull whith various hues. Prague was mostly untouched during the war so is quite intact. A very interesting side trip would be to Cesky Krumlov. Its a 13th century village that is untouched by wars with the 2nd largest Castle in the Republic. You could do it in one day or stay overnight. <BR>Visit the Charles bridge in the evening and walk around castle hill during the day. Visit the old Jewish cematery. It's like nothing I've ever seen. Many outdoor cafe's to visit. They have the first birs ever made, Pilsner Urquel and Budwise. They are almost as good as German bier. <BR>Have a great trip. <BR>Art <BR>
